The county continues to record high numbers of new COVID cases.
There are still around 170 COVID cases in North Yorkshire's hospitals and the county is continuing to see COVID deaths on a weekly basis.
The seven day infection rates in the county remain above the national average with most confirmed cases in school age children and the over 65's
Public Health consultant Dr Victoria Turner says cases have been creeping up in recent weeks.
The latest numbers show there are around 400 new confirmed cases of COVID a day in North Yorkshire with around 73 a day in the Scarborough Borough.

Public Health consultant Dr Victoria Turner says there has been a shift in the age groups presenting with COVID in the last few weeks.
